Abstract:
Objective:To summarize and analyze the risk factors associated with bronchial mucus plugs (BMPs) in children with Mycoplasma pneumoniae pneumonia (MPP),providing a clinical basis for the indication of bronchoscopy in children with MPP.Methods:A total of 72 children with MPP admitted to the Department of Pediatrics at the Fourth Affiliated Hospital of Nanjing Medical University from December 2022 to December 2024,who underwent bronchoscopy,were selected for this study.According to the presence or absence of BMPs under tracheoscopy,the patients were divided into the mucus plug group and the non-mucus plug group,and their clinical data were analyzed and compared.Results:Among the 72 children with MPP,30 cases (41.7%) were in the mucus plug group,while 42 cases (58.3%) were in the non-mucus plug group.Univariate Logistic regression analysis showed that thermal peak ( OR 2.086,95% CI 1.029-4.299, P=0.041),thermal duration ( OR 1.453,95% CI 1.197-1.763, P < 0.001),thermal duration ≥10 days ( OR 26.154,95% CI 5.316-128.661, P<0.001),combined with pleural effusion ( OR 4.727,95% CI 1.136-19.677, P=0.033),atelectasis ( OR 5.636,95% CI 2.024-15.699, P<0.001),lymphocyte proportion( OR 0.936,95% CI 0.888-0.978, P=0.014),neutrophil proportion( OR 1.048,95% CI 1.005-1.093, P=0.028),lactatedehydrogenase ( OR 1.005,95% CI 1.001-1.009, P = 0.028),D-dimer ( OR 2.203,95% CI 1.133-4.280, P = 0.020),fibrin degradation products ( OR 1.563,95% CI 1.095-2.231, P=0.014),and no heat regression within 72 hours of hormone use ( OR 0.239,95% CI 0.085-0.667, P=0.006) were significant influencing factors for the formation of BMPs in children with MPP.Multivariate Logistic regression analysis showed that thermal duration ≥10 days and atelectasis were independent risk factors for BMPs formation ( P<0.05). Conclusion:For MPP children with thermal duration≥10 days,especially with atelectasis,BMPs may have been formed,and it is recommended to perform bronchoscopy as soon as possible.
